Please review the following job description:

Support Producers, Marketing Account Executives, Marketing Specialists, Client Account Executives and other teammates in the preparation for and execution of marketing and placement of insurance coverages with carriers on both new and renewal business. Support Producers in sales activities, as requested. Build and grow relationships with clients, carrier representatives, and teammates. Become knowledgeable of applicable coverages, carrier guidelines, alternative funding arrangements, underwriting, and legislative changes.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Following is a summary of the essential functions for this job. Other duties may be performed, both major and minor, which are not mentioned below. Specific activities may change from time to time.
1. Assist the Producer and account teams collecting prospect and client information.
2. Obtain loss runs, preparing loss summaries, and preparing loss history analyses, stratifications, and loss forecasters as requested.
3. Research claims issues as related to loss runs/loss summaries.
4. Obtain, perform analyses of, and/or review experience mod worksheet calculations and relevant information from other analytical and evaluative tools and sources.
5. Quote/rate various online programs for multiple insurance carriers.
6. Support the submission process, including to but not limited to assisting in the development of submissions, creating transmittal communications for sending submissions to carriers.
7. Follow up with carriers to confirm receipt of submissions and assist with obtaining and providing additional information requested by carriers.
8. Compare coverages, terms, and conditions of quotes.
+. Prepare proposals, finance agreements, other presentations, and/or certificates of coverage as requested
10. Become proficient with the usage and ability to learn all relevant insurance company rating programs.
11. Creating documents/spreadsheets to assist in marketing of accounts.
12. Document account/computer files per procedures and requirements as requested.
13. Understand NFIP guidelines and requests for policy issuance.
14. Process binder request forms and supporting documentation as requested.
15. Attend and meet with carrier representatives, as requested.
16. Become knowledgeable about insurance carrier products and programs.
17. Build and maintain key client and carrier relationships by phone, email, and in person.
18. Assist Producers in sales efforts, including responding to Requests for Proposals and participating in prospect meetings as requested.
1+. Understand and utilize the client management system(s) and other relevant technology platforms.
20. Attend seminars, classes, and carrier meetings to keep abreast of new products available for clients and acquire expertise in legislative changes.
21. Other projects, job duties, and responsibilities as requested by Producers, account teams, and/or management.

QUALIFICATIONS
Required Qualifications:
The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
1. High School Diploma or equivalent education
2. Relevant insurance industry education, training, or experience
3. Appropriate insurance license (Property & Casualty)
4. Basic insurance knowledge with a strong desire to learn and achieve insurance designations such as Accredited Advisor in Insurance (AAI), INS, Certified Insurance Counselor (CIC), (Certified Risk Manager) CRM, Chartered Property Casualty Underwriter (CPCU)) or equivalent
5. Strong communication and interpersonal skills to build and maintain positive business relationships with clients, market contacts, and McGriff teammates
6. Strong persuasion skills and tact to obtain information and successfully interact with clients, carriers, and teammates
7. Discretion and analytical skills to analyze client information, proposal competitiveness, etc
8. Demonstrated proficiency in basic computer applications such as Microsoft Office Suite
+. Ability to travel overnight

Preferred Qualifications:
1. College degree or equivalent education and/or experience
2. Insurance industry certifications in addition to necessary license(s)
3. Significant prior insurance industry experience and knowledge of carriers and markets
